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Veranda: Larger verandas require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Type of Wood: Premium woods like cedar or redwood are more expensive than treated pine or fir.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s with custom features will raise the price compared to simpler structures.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ations in Eugene, OR may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Labor Costs: The cost of skilled labor in Eugene can vary, impacting the total expenditure.
- Additional Features: Adding elements like railings, lighting, or built-in seating will increase the cost.
- Site Preparation: Grading, leveling, and clearing the site can add to the overall expense.
Average Costs for
Task | Average Cost in Eugene, OR |
---|---|
Basic Veranda Construction | $5,000 - $10,000 |
Premium Wood Materials |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Custom Design Features | $1,500 - $4,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$200 - $600 |
Labor Costs (per hour) | $50 - $100 |
Site Preparation | $500 - $2,000 |
Additional Features | $300 - $1,500 |
